One of the lessons I've learned in my weight loss is that it's helpful to surround myself with inspiration. Motivation dies out so quickly, so I need a lot of incentives to keep me on track. Last year, I used a Smash Book as a scrapbook and journal to keep track of my progress and my goals. I had lists of meals that I liked, progress pictures, fun activities, bucket lists, rewards for different goals, and all kinds of things. Anything that I thought would help keep me focused went into it. Now that it's a new year, I'm going to start a new Smash Book. I haven't decided what all to include yet, but I can't wait to get it started.
